The Critical Role of Library Mods in Modding Ecosystems

To the casual observer, a library mod like Nevoka Core might seem redundant. Why install a file that does not appear to change the game world? The answer lies in software efficiency and stability. In modern mod development, authors often create multiple distinct mods that share common codebases. Without a central core, every single mod would need to contain its own copy of shared utilities, rendering engines, and networking protocols. This leads to bloated file sizes, increased memory consumption, and a high probability of conflicts when two mods try to load the same code differently.

By extracting these shared elements into Nevoka Core for Minecraft: The Backbone of Tech Mods, the developer ensures that all dependent projects speak the same language. This centralization allows for smoother updates; when the core is patched to support a new version of the game or fix a critical bug, every mod relying on it instantly benefits without needing individual updates. For the end-user, this translates to a significantly more stable experience, whether playing in a solitary single-player world or managing a bustling multiplayer server. It is the invisible glue that holds the technical landscape together, preventing the chaotic crashes that often plague heavily modded installations.

Functional Overview: What Does the Core Actually Do?

While the primary function of this module is backend support, it does offer tangible improvements to the user interface that enhance the overall quality of life. Unlike content mods that flood the creative inventory with hundreds of new blocks, Nevoka Core focuses on refinement. One notable feature included in this library is a quality-of-life adjustment to the game's title screen. Specifically, it introduces a dedicated button to return directly to the game from the Credits screen.

This may seem like a minor detail, but in the context of large-scale technical modpacks, such conveniences accumulate. Players spending hours configuring complex networks of pipes, drives, and processors often find themselves navigating menus frequently. Reducing the number of clicks required to return to gameplay streamlines the experience, making the modpack feel more polished and professional. It demonstrates a commitment to user experience that goes beyond mere functionality, acknowledging that navigation efficiency is part of the enjoyment loop in long-term play sessions.
